Course Content

• Sustainable Fertilizer Management Principles
• Soil Health and Nutrient Cycling (includes keywords: soil testing, organic matter)
• Precision Fertilizer Application Technologies (includes keywords: GPS, variable rate technology)
• Nutrient Management Planning and Optimization
• Environmental Impacts of Fertilizer Use (includes keywords: water pollution, greenhouse gas emissions)
• Fertilizer Economics and Policy
• Integrated Nutrient Management Strategies (includes keywords: cover crops, crop rotation)
• Sustainable Fertilizer Alternatives (includes keywords: biofertilizers, compost)
• Monitoring and Evaluation of Fertilizer Use Efficiency

Career path

Career Role (Sustainable Fertilizer Use) Description
Agricultural Consultant (Sustainable Farming) Advising farmers on optimal fertilizer application, minimizing environmental impact. High demand due to increasing focus on sustainable agriculture.
Soil Scientist (Sustainable Land Management) Analyzing soil health and nutrient levels to guide fertilizer choices, promoting soil fertility and reducing pollution. Critical role in sustainable land use.
Environmental Consultant (Fertilizer Management) Assessing the environmental impact of fertilizer use, developing mitigation strategies. Growing demand due to stricter environmental regulations.
Agronomist (Precision Agriculture & Fertilizer) Utilizing technology for precise fertilizer application, maximizing yields while minimizing waste and pollution. A key role in the modern sustainable farm.
